    I personally think Clone Wars wins. Rebels was good, but at first it seemed for little kids, but then it threw in characters like Thrawn and Ahsoka to get older Star Wars fans involved but then would switch it up, reverting back to more childish themes. For example, one thing that rubbed me the wrong way was in that episode where Saw, Sabine and Ezra come out of a shuttle and are faced with Death Troopers. I thought that the Rebels would be forced back into the shuttle. But instead, the Death Troopers are the same as their bumbling stormtrooper counterparts, and they don't have their scramblers on! Also, when Sabine threw her smoke bomb, I thought that they would have filters to see through it, but they did not. Aside from other examples of Stupid Imperial Syndrome, great show!(TWILIGHT OF THE APRENTICCCE) but not as good as Clone Wars.

    The Clone Wars for sure.

    It expanded the Star Wars mythos and several arcs are some of the best that Star Wars has to offer. Best animation too; it starts off rough but it ends up being on-par with Disney and Pixar’s theatrical releases, especially in this recent season.

    I do have to give credit where credit is due though, Rebels did add quite a few interesting things to the Star Wars universe and it definitely took more risks I’d say. (Which is easier to do when you don’t follow a cast of characters who mostly already have their fates set in stone.) It’s also much more consistent I quality. With The Clone Wars, you could be getting something great, like the Siege of Mandalore or Umbara arc, or you could be getting something crappy, like any of the episodes that focus on the droids.

    And while Resistance has very little to add to Star Wars, it’s cool that it technically did the crossover-with-the-films aspect first. (The Siege of Mandalore only just cane out and Rebels only had tie-ins with Rogue One and the Orig Trig, there was still always a time gap between them.)
